Good start is with Psalm 15…The Christian Constitution Character…love this quote from Oswald Chambers
“My worth to God in public is what I am in private”.
To be a woman with character means understanding your role as a servant.
What’s the difference between character and reputation?
Reputation is who people think you are.
Character is who you really are.
God knows the difference, so do you.
Share together, talk together, grow together and pray together.
Ask God to show you areas in your character that need refining. Be willing to participate in God’s plan for improvement. Let’s make a commitment to change where needed.
Consider reading Psalm 15 daily for a month.
“Character is what you are in the dark” Dwight L. Moody.
